1. AI-Powered Wedding Planning Assistants
Remember that friend who seems to know everything about weddings and can answer questions at 3 AM? Now imagine having that friend in your pocket 24/7. That’s what AI wedding planning assistants offer.
These smart tools can:
- Create personalized timelines based on your wedding date
- Suggest vendors within your budget and style preferences
- Help you track RSVPs and dietary requirements
- Send automated reminders for appointments and deadlines
- Generate seating arrangements based on your guests’ relationships
But here’s the real magic: these assistants learn from your preferences and decisions, becoming more helpful over time. It’s like having a wedding planner who knows exactly what you want before you even say it.

3. Virtual Reality Venue Tours
Gone are the days of driving hundreds of miles to view potential venues. Virtual reality tours are revolutionizing how couples choose their perfect wedding location.
Imagine sitting on your couch, putting on a VR headset, and suddenly standing in a beautiful ballroom or garden venue. You can:
- Walk through the space at your own pace
- View the venue at different times of day
- Test different decoration setups virtually
- Check sight lines from guest tables
- Explore outdoor spaces regardless of weather
Pro tip: Many venues now offer both VR tours and “hybrid” tours where you can do an initial virtual walkthrough and then visit your top choices in person.
4. Digital Wedding Design Platforms
Remember trying to explain your vision to vendors using Pinterest boards and magazine cutouts? Digital wedding design platforms take this to the next level.
These platforms let you:
- Create 3D mockups of your ceremony and reception spaces
- Test different color schemes in real-time
- Experiment with lighting options
- Place virtual furniture and decorations
- Share exact specifications with vendors

5. Smart Registry and Gift Management
Traditional wedding registries were limited to one or two stores. Today’s smart registry platforms are revolutionizing how couples create and manage their wish lists.
Modern registry platforms offer:
- The ability to add items from any store worldwide
- Group gifting options for bigger items
- Cash fund options for experiences or home down payments
- Automatic thank-you note tracking
- Price monitoring to catch sales on registry items

Common Concerns Addressed
“What if something goes wrong with the technology?” Always have a backup plan. For example, with EventLive, you can do a test run before the wedding day and have multiple devices ready to stream.
“Won’t this make wedding planning feel impersonal?” Technology should enhance, not replace, the personal aspects of wedding planning. Use it to handle tedious tasks so you can focus on the meaningful moments.
“Is it worth the investment?” Consider the time and stress you’ll save. Many couples report that tech solutions actually helped them stay under budget by providing better organization and preventing impulse purchases.
